Modern digital audiences make decisions incredibly fast. Within just a few seconds of landing on a website, visitors often decide whether to continue exploring or leave immediately. For small and medium sized businesses, this short window of attention can determine whether a potential customer becomes a qualified lead or disappears permanently. High bounce rates frequently occur not because businesses lack quality services, but because websites fail to communicate value quickly enough. This is why the concept of the “hook above the fold” has become one of the most important principles in effective website strategy. The phrase “above the fold” refers to the section of a website visible immediately before users begin scrolling. This first screen acts as the digital storefront of the business.
